Aside from the JE, make sure you understand the concepts of reducing the Number of shares outstanding with Treasury stock, increasing EPS, dividends not paid out on treasury shares, treasury shares being protected from dilution in stock splits, and all treasury stock activity is on BS, not P&L.

That is the important underlying concept of treasury, more important than memorizing the JE.

Depreciation methods, pv, npv, effective interest rate. That’s what I remember. 

But not just the formula. Learn how to set up all the involved questions in excel. Example. Inventory valuations (fifo/lifo) , cost accounting, leases etc. 

Idk if you use the excel at work, but if you use it on exam, you just set up your table, enter the info they are asking. And boom. U have your answer. 

You can copy charts and tables from sims or mcq straight into excel and manipulate it there.

I took far last week. 

what you should know well is the journal entries behind every single transaction.

Know F1 and understand it very well. (All equity activity for those not using Becker )

And know how to set up your lease and bond tables on excel. 

In your final review. I would say focus 1 day on bonds, 1 day leases and 1 day equity. (Stock splits , stock dividends, EPS, OCI) etc  Immerse yourself in those topics.  

If you know the basics well, you’ll be fine. Example : understanding the basics of how everything impacts the p&L and BS is more important than focusing on dollar value lifo.

I studied about 2 hours in the morning. Those were my solid learning hours.  

+

MCQ all day whenever I was able to sit with my phone for a minute, I pulled out the Becker app. 

Audio lectures in my ears whenever I couldn’t be doing MCQ. ( also listened to some ninja final review in my ears)

I mainly did lectures in the evening, but dedicated my prime study time to working through MCQ problems 

Weekends approx 4 hours a day. 

mainly sims and anything hard that I didn’t understand during the week. Reading the book, watching other YouTube explanations. Etc. 

Final review.  I can’t do anything for too long.  So just split my time with reviewing all sims, MCQ, flash cards, memorizing printed tables. Etc.
